The owners of TikTok are reportedly close to selling Mobile Legends: Bang Bang to the Saudi-backed Savvy Games Group

ByteDance, the owner of the popular social network TikTok, is in the late stages of negotiations to sell its game studio Shanghai Moonton Technology to Saudi Arabia’s Savvy Games Group.
According to Reuters sources, the deal could be valued between $6–7 billion, with the contract potentially being signed as early as this quarter (meaning before the end of March 2026).

Moonton's most notable project is the mobile MOBA Mobile Legends: Bang Bang (MLBB). It was this title’s massive success that led ByteDance to acquire Moonton in 2021 through its gaming division Nuverse for roughly $4 billion.

In 2023, ByteDance announced a restructuring of its gaming business following an internal review. Selling Moonton would become one of the company’s biggest steps away from online gaming.
If the deal goes through, it would also mark another major move in Saudi Arabia’s strategy to dominate mobile gaming and esports, aligning with the broader global consolidation trend—where companies compete for IP, distribution channels, and scale.
